The guiding question of the research is: which characteristics of Recreational Mathematics can be evidenced through the principles of the Theory of Objectivation, enhancing its use in the classroom? As a research objective, we proposed to investigate the theoretical-methodological contributions of the Theory of Objectification to the proposition of Recreational Mathematics tasks in the classroom. In this context, the established thesis is that Recreational Mathematics tasks, based on the Joint Labor and the Community Ethics of the Theory of Objectification, contribute to the student's mathematical formation as a citizen in a historical-cultural community. To this end, a mapping activity was carried out focusing on research in Recreational Mathematics using Theses and Dissertations produced between 1994 and 2018. This mapping contributed to the understanding of Recreational Mathematics as a methodological approach that can provide motivation, pleasure and fun, among other positive aspects. This study has a qualitative exploratory approach, uses the multimodal analysis method and is based on the Theory of Objectification. Thus, a Didactic-Pedagogical proposal was organized in the light of the Theory of Objectification, in order to present to the Mathematics graduate students the Recreational Mathematics in its most relevant aspects, both from the point of view of problem solving and pedagogical reflections. Thus, an exploratory workshop on Recreational Mathematics was developed for teachers and students of Mathematics Degree. As for the pedagogical intervention, it consisted of five tasks to be developed with the the graduates of Mathematics degree at the Federal University of Rio Grande do Norte (UFRN/Natal). However, only Task 1 of the proposed intervention was applied. As for the workshop analysis, we found that students and teachers were interested in reading and solving the Recreational Problem in a fun and pleasurable way, promoting a work of human cooperation, nourished by the ethics of responsibility, commitment and care for others. In relation to Task 1 provided, the students with ethical and reflective thoughts, as they worked in a collaborative environment through Joint Labor and supported by a Community Ethics.
